Continued: D E A T H S Henry Harrison Wiatt son of W.C. and Mary Wiatt, departed this life the 28th day of August 1863, age 23 years, 2 mo. and 16 days. Buried in Brewerville Cemetery 2 miles north of Coatapa, Ala. He was in Lee’s Cavalry in Virginia, came home on sick furlough and died three weeks later. --------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------- reference: 1860 United States Federal Census Name: W H Wiatt Age: 20 Birth Year: 1840 Gender: Male Birth Place: Virginia Home in 1860: Southern Division, Sumter, Alabama Post Office: Livingston Dwelling Number: 454 Family Number: 454 Occupation: Farm Laborer Household Members: Name / Age / Birth Place Mary Wiatt 48 Va M C Wiatt 47 Va J F Wiatt 22 Va W H Wiatt 20 Va Source Citation: Year: 1860; Census Place: Southern Division, Sumter, Alabama; Roll: M653_24; Page: 522; Family History Library Film: 803024 Source Information: Ancestry.com. 1860 United States Federal Census [database on-line].
